Lebanese Finance Minister Youssef Jaber affirmed that Lebanon is Going through one of the most difficult phases in its history, due to the ongoing war which has caused enormous human and economic damage, destroyed villages and institutions, and increased population displacements and disruptions to economic activities. Despite these challenges, he pointed out that the Lebanese people remain committed to reforms and the International Monetary Fund program, which is considered a key element in their recovery strategy. This program aims to restore confidence and attract external financial support to achieve sustainable growth. He also stated that the future of European-Arab cooperation should focus on enhancing economic resilience, integration, and sustainable growth. This was during his participation in the international economic summit held in Paris under the auspices of French President Emmanuel Macron.
